AutoPower Forum

AutoPower Diskussion

Bilstereo Navi Tele Ljud Larm
4.603

Någon sugen på delta i CarPC projekt?

Sida 1 av 2
Hej!

Såhär i jul och mellandagarna har jag tänkt att äntligen komma igång lite med mitt länge planerade CarPC-projekt. :-)

Det kommer att bli en Mini-ITX (liten X86-PC) baserad burk som jag tänkte hänga under hatthyllan i skuffen. För att testa grundkonceptet har jag tagit hem Varan (www.varan.org), men därefter har jag tänkt att plocka ihop ett "superpaket" själv, baserat på Linux, som skall kunna gå att byggas ut och tunas i det oändliga (långsiktigt mål...)

Så jag tänkte fråga om det finns fler BMW ägare på detta forum som skulle vara intresserade av att bygga liknande system för era egna bilar, och som skulle vilja vara med och delta och bidra med olika delar i projektet.
Själv är jag duktig på elektronik och programmering av kommunikation och "lågnivågrejor", men jag skulle helt klart kunna ha nytta av lite stöttning på userinterface delarna (=skitsnygg grafisk design + ljud baserat på "skins" så att man kan byta), och sedan ser jag framför mig en hel radda med olika mjukvarufunktioner man skulle kunna dela upp mellan sig på att implementera.

Förutom programmerare och GUI designers så behöver vi givetvis ett antal villiga testare av systemet, med så många olika BMW modeller som möjligt.
Själv har jag en 750 med DSP (=digital 2 kanalig audioingång) och 4:3 videoskärm), men min avsikt är att systemet skall funka även med tilläggsmonterade skärmar (tex 7" widescreens) och andra audiokonfigurationer (5:1 surround!), så enda begränsningen jag hade tänkt mig är att modellen måste ha någon form av kommmunikationsbuss att ansluta på.

För att snabbt komma igång köpte jag ett I-bus (ISO9141) interface av Rolf Resler, men bättre isolerade sådana skulle jag enkelt kunna bygga en drös av på jobbet och sälja till självkostnadspris om intresse verkar finnas. Jag skulle även kunna ordna CAN/MOST interface (för de nyare modellerna, tror E60/E65 kör med detta) om intresse finns.

Mvh. /Kjell
Visa användare
219
beni1979
323ci-00_e46
jag vill ju installera pc i bilen om jag kan ha navigator i den och jag tänkte köra med en touch screen

Länk
Länk
ch
54
chip
325i -94
Hej!

jag är intresserad, men iom studier(så jag också ska bli duktig på att elektronik och programmering) så har jag ej ekonomi förrän till sommaren.

Men jag har en fråga till dig, jag har ju en äldre bil, e36:a och jag funderar på om man skulle kunna integrera färddatorn i datorsystemet för bilen. Hur svårt är det att bygga ett interface som tar alla mätdata färddatorn får in och istället skickar det till en dator, via tex comporten?
Hej beni och chip,

beni; är det huvudsakligen navigator du är intresserad av är troligen en handdator med tillkopplad GPS mottagare + nav-mjukvara det både enklaste och billigaste alternativet. Dessutom är ju en sådan även utmärkt som MP3 spelare, så det är inget dumt alternativ.
Men annars: ja - jag tänkte mig att även navigation skulle vara en applikation man skulle kunna köra på CarPC:n med inkopplad GPS mottagare. GPS mottagare för inkoppling via t.ex USB vet jag finns idag både billiga och bra, men jag har inte själv rotat i vilka navigationsapplikationer man skulle kunna använda eftersom den funktionen inte direkt står på min egen priolista (jag har separat nav).

chip; jag är _nästan_ säker på att din E36:a har I-Bus precis som min E38:a, och just sådan integration är precis en av de centrala saker jag vill göra med CarPC:n - den skall kunna styras från rattknappar + färddatorknapppar, och den skall kunna visa meddelanden på färddatorns display.
En I-Bus är i grunden en vanlig serieport ("comport"), men på datorn används spänningsnivåerna +/-10V, medan man i bilen kör med 0/12V. Därför behövs bara ett relativt enkelt spänningskonverterarinterface för att koppla in en dator på I-bussen. Rolf Resler (www.reslers.de) säljer sådan både som byggsats och färdigbyggda för några få hundralappar.
På I-bussen skickas en massa kul info som datorn kan lyssna på, och sedan kan den både logga och presentera detta på betydligt fler och mer givande sätt än en vanlig färddator, det är här det roligaste med en CarPC kommer in om du frågar just mig. ;-)

Kostnaderna för en baskonfiguration kan vara ganska måttliga, själv har jag köpt på mig följande:
- Ett Mini-ITX PC-moderkort med integrerad CPU, grafik och ljud, ca 1500:-
- 256MB RAM, tja vad kostar det, några hundralappar...
- En hårddisk, jag väljer en 2.5" laptopdisk pga att dessa är mer stöttåliga, ca 1000:-
- En Mini-ITX datorlåda, inkl powersupply som kan matas med 12V DC, ca 1500:-

Summa: Drygt 4000:-, och då tycker jag egentligen att lådan är alldeles för dyr och klumpig, så jag skulle gärna se att någon hittar en mindre och billigare.

Dessutom har jag pga att Mini-ITX kortens digitala audioutgång inte har en samplerate som är kompatibel med digitalingången på min DSP i bilen lagt till ett M-Audio Audiophile PCI-ljudkort för ca en 1000-lapp, men egentligen tror jag att det mer rätta skulle varit att helt plocka bort DSP:n och köra detta i datorn också, jag tror faktiskt t.o.m att ljudet som kan åstadkommas av de integrerade ljudchippen på ett VIA Mini-ITX kort är minst lika bra (dåligt) som BMWs professional DSP system... Men jag tänkte spara detta till ettt senare steg, så jag köpte ljudkortet att använda så länge.

Mvh. /Kjell
ol
649
olja
Merca med skruvad sexa.
Kjell:

Finns det inte tillräckligt med liknande projekt redan? Vi har redan Carx, Varan, CarAmp, Bebox o.s.v..

Jag har kört med en Mini-ITX(VIA M10000) PC+7" petskärm + Reslers I-bus IF kopplad till min Business-CD. Som UI har jag haft Mediacar + Destinator för navigeringen, har fungerat bra.

Mitt nästa steg är att slänga ut Business-CD:n och köra direkt från PC:n till original Hifi-förstärkaren. Ljudchippen på VIA moderkorten är ingen höjdare. Jag fick in diverse ljud från hårddisken m.m.. Det blir ett riktigt ljudkort i bil-PC V 1.1.

Vad har du tänkt dig för DC-DC nätdel? Jag har införskaffat ett ´
90W OPUS till V 1.1.

Kan inte Windows XP Embedded vara ett intressant alternativ?

Chip: Jag är ganska säker(99.99%) på att E36 inte har I-bus.

/Johan



Riktiga män kör sedan.
Projekt som dessa är alltid intressanta, samtidigt skall man ju inte uppfinna hjulet i onödan, som olja skriver.
Rekommenderar ett besök hos hack-the-ibus på Yahoos diskussionsforum om man vill grotta sig i just i-bussen.

FP
Håller själv på med ett litet projekt att slänga in dator i bilen. Tänkte bara had den som musik databas så de blir ingen skärm än så länge. Tänkte styra den med hjälp av telefon och programet Bemused.
Men har en fundering. Kan de finnas någon möjlighet att få en dator att boota från usb? Skulle vara perfekt om man skulle få operativsystemet att gå på ett usbminne, Mera stötsäkert är svårt att hitta. Sen tänkte ja lagra musik på helt vanliga hård diskar.
Men just operativsystemet skulle man inte ju vilja att de skall krascha ihop vid en ordentlig stöt.
ol
649
olja
Merca med skruvad sexa.
js-nicke: Det går att få Windows att boota från ett USB-minne. Alternativt kan du köra med Compactflash på IDE. Tyvärr lär ditt minne inte hålla så värst länge p.g.a. alla skrivningarna. Det går att få windows att låta bli att skriva till ditt flashminne med komponenter från XP embedded. Surfa in på Länk och sök på ewf.

/Johan

Riktiga män kör sedan.
Hejhej på er,

Jag är mycket medveten om att det finns ett flertal befintliga CarPC projekt, både kommersiella och gratisgrejor, men eftersom detta är en hobbygrej jag håller på med för mitt eget höga nöjes skull är själva tjusningen för mig att göra det själv! :-)
Eftersom jag jobbar professionellt med ett företag som utvecklar open-source baserade inbyggda styrsystem har jag inte heller intresserat mig nämnvärt för de Microsoft baserade alternativen, men jag har givetvis kolllat in lite vilka funktioner de olika befintliga lösningarna erbjuder.
Primärt är som sagt inte mitt eget fokus riktat mot t.ex Nav eller Multimedia, utan jag kommer först att lattja lite med att göra en superfärddator som kan ge lite grafritande loggar, låta bilen mejla mig körjournaler etc, men jag tänkte att om någon annan är mer intresserade av dessa bitar skulle man kunna samarbeta.

olja; har du problem med "hårddiskljud" o liknande på ljudkanalerna skulle jag rekommendera dig att först se över jordningen av din CarPC, detta har knappast något med ljudchippen i sig att göra. Opus DC/DC aggregaten har jag inte testat, men på specen verkar de OK. Själv kör jag just nu bara med att jag köpt en Morex Mini-ITX låda med inbyggd DC/DC nätdel som matas med 12V, som jag 30-matat via 2st 5A dioder i serie och en 15V zener mot jord. Detta är dock ingen långsiktig lösning, då jag troligen kommer att byta till ett XScale baserat kort lite längre fram.

Att kunna boota en PC från ett USB minne är något som PC:n BIOS behöver kunna stödja, och sådana börjar dyka upp fler och fler numera. Flertalet av Mini-ITX korten gör det, och många modernare laptops gör det också. Stöds det inte av ditt BIOS är mycket riktigt ett CompactFlash kort i en IDE adapter också ett alternativ.
Linux, och *BSD varianterna kan man enkelt konfigurera så att skrivaccesser till utslitbara lagringsmedia (ja, flash sliter man sönder annars) inte görs, men beroende på vilket flashminne man köper kan dessa slitas mer eller mindrre snabbt. En vän till mig har plockat ihop en båt-PC som han kör Microsoft 98 från CF kort på, men han köpte ett dyrare "industrial grade" CF kort och har nu använt det i 2 säsonger utan att minnet gått sönder (dessa minnen har redundanta sektorer, som kortets interna logik mappar över trasiga sektorer då de uppstår).

God fortsättning!
Mvh. /Kjell
olja: OK, tack för svaret!
ol
649
olja
Merca med skruvad sexa.
Kjell: Har du kunskap och möjlighet att pyssla med mjukvaran själv är Linux klart intressant. För oss vanliga dödliga är nog Windows XP att föredra. Det finns mängder med roliga frontends att välja på. Tyvärr är mina kunskaper i programmering begränsade (Basic).

Det var inte jordningen som ställde till det. Problemet försvann när jag flyttade hårddisken längre ifrån moderkortet. Inget att bekymra sig om du kör digitalt ut.

Är inte K-bussen intressantare vid ett ev. färddatorprojekt? Du kan få ut allt möjligt kul därifrån, diagnostik m.m..

/Johan

Riktiga män kör sedan.
mb
270
mbri
435i Cab -15
Land ROver LR2 -12
Hittade denna länk:

Länk

Det ser helt klart ut att vara intressant. Är det någon som monterat det här på forumet?

/Mikael

Min bil: Länk
ol
649
olja
Merca med skruvad sexa.
mbri: En Ikea låda i en BMW!! Passar bäst i en V-lvo! Vad har han handdatorn till??

Ungefär samma komponenter jag hade i min e39 bilpc V1.0. (undantaget Ikealådan) Jag fick in datorn i utrymmet bakom vänster hjulhus. Med I-Bus IF gick det att styra Mediacar med rattknapparna.

/Johan

Riktiga män kör sedan.
Visa användare
1.024
Alf_VON_Sil
BMW X4 20d
Jeep Wrangler YJ
"Skogsbesten"
Helt klart intressant! Men det finns redan ganska många lösningar, de har hållit på ett par år, det är ett jävla jobb att försöka få till det bättre än dem klarat.

Att köra windows XP i bildatorn fungerar bra, du har ström funktionerna, och med en hel del meck så lyckas jag starta hela skiten på 8 sekunder. Bort med gui osv osv. på en väldigt enkel CPU och en halvgig ram.

Själv installerade jag ett DSP filter i datorn och fick bra mycket mera kräm i ljudet.

Mitt tips är att testa CarX vilket har vuxit en hel del sista tiden.

Lycka till!

Mvh
Kristian

Jag tycker du ska försöka men det lär ju ta ett par år förrän det brukar likna nått.
ol
649
olja
Merca med skruvad sexa.
Alf_VON_Sil: Hur har får du igång din burk på 8 sekunder?

/Johan

Riktiga män kör sedan.
Visa användare
1.024
Alf_VON_Sil
BMW X4 20d
Jeep Wrangler YJ
"Skogsbesten"
olja: Nu var det ett tag sedan så jag kommer inte ihåg allt jag gjorde.
Men Basic sakerna har jag skrivit i mitt dokument om CarAMP och CarX som det finns länkar till här på forumet.

Det går att snabba upp XP förvånansvärt mycket, home edition startar snabbare än PRO version, skala bort allt som verkligen inte behövs. Stäng av diverse tjänster, hacka lite i registret hämta hem programvaror som optimerar start av datorn, stäng av att drivrutiner ska vänta på hårdvaran eller att annan drivrutin ska starta, Använder du USB tex? om inte ta bort skiten helt. Stäng av kontroll av NTFS partioner, Stripe GUI:et ta bort så mycket GUI du bara kan.
Bara att nämna några saker..

Det tog lite tid, men sök på nätet, det finns sidor om detta. Tyvärr fann jag ingen sida som bara handlar om ämnet utan man får plocka rusin ur tårtan liksom, har tyvärr inga länkar kvar.

Mvh
Kristian
seyaa
olja hur installerade du destinator på en pc? den villl bara installera på en handdator för mej????

vart får ni tag på mediacar?

/jonas
ol
649
olja
Merca med skruvad sexa.
Seyaa: Länk

Riktiga män kör sedan.
ol
649
olja
Merca med skruvad sexa.
Seyaa: Glömde denna Länk

Riktiga män kör sedan.
seyaa
man tackar pefekt ska prova ikväll :)
ol
649
olja
Merca med skruvad sexa.
Seyaa: Hör av dig om du behöver den modifierade DLL:en.

/Johan

Riktiga män kör sedan.
Du måste vara en registrerad användare för att kunna göra inlägg här.
Klicka här för att registrera dig. Registreringen är gratis.
Är du redan användare? Logga in i menyn.